The Fennelbird crash-report pipeline ingests symbols from the Quarrow build farm. On-call: do not restart the symbolicator without approval. Backlog over 50k events triggers the pager; drain via the replay queue, never by dropping partitions. Schema changes to the crash envelope require a signed approval in the Lanterndeck tracker before deploy. Retention overrides (beyond 30 days) need the same. If approval is blocked after hours, escalate once, then wait. The approver of record for all pipeline changes is listed below.

named custodian: Oliath Ralax

**Mgmt Meeting Minutes — Retiring the Brightline Range**

Quick recap for sales leads at Fenholt Supplies: we agreed to retire the Brightline fixture range by year-end. Remaining stock moves to clearance pricing next month, and accounts on standing orders get migrated to the Lumetta range. Trade-in incentives were approved in principle. The confidential note on next steps sits just below.

board note of bajof-bajeg: The pricing group signed off on a budget of $13.4 million for Project Sildor. The renewal with Lamixek Holdings closes at $48.9 million a year, 49 percent above the last contract.

# Env Vars: Planner Regression Mitigation

After the query planner regression in Corvid DB 9.3, Fernwell's release builds must pin the legacy planner until the patched build ships. Set `CORVID_PLANNER_MODE=legacy` in the release env file and confirm it with the preflight check before tagging. The planner override endpoint requires authentication, so the release env file also needs the planner override token on the next line.

env line for kahof-fajeg: ARCHIVE_KEY3=397

## Graphtrace API — On-call Notes

Graphtrace renders dependency graphs for Loomworks services. If renders hang, restart the `graphtrace-worker` pool and clear the layout cache. The `/rebuild` endpoint forces a full graph recompute; use sparingly, it's expensive. All internal calls go through the Meshgate proxy. To invoke `/rebuild` during an incident, authenticate to Meshgate with the key below.

gateway credential: kto3_qfe